Fiumicino (FCO) renamed as Leonardo da Vinci, is known as the largest airport in Rome, opened in stages between 1956 and 1961 and it has been undergone several expansion works. The airport is 19 miles (30km) south west of central Rome, where takes around 45 minutes from Rome, which located the Fiumicino , where is a large fishing town on the Tyrrhenian Sea coast ... More> and has long been known for its great seafood restaurants. It also is a weekend getaway for the people of Rome, especially in the summer. There is a good beach but the sand is black due to the high iron content in it. Transports provided from central Rome are bus, train, taxi.
